Použití zástupných znaků při porovnávání řetězců

Důležité :  Tento článek je strojově přeložený – přečtěte si toto upozornění. Anglickou verzi tohoto článku pro referenci najdete tady.

Předdefinované vzorů představuje univerzální nástroj pro porovnávání řetězců. V následující tabulce jsou uvedeny zástupné znaky, které můžete použít s operátor Like a počet číslic nebo řetězce, které se shodují.

Znaky v vzorek

Odpovídající výrazu

? nebo _ (podtržítko)

Libovolný jednotlivý znak

* nebo %

Žádný nebo více znaků

#

Libovolná jednotlivá číslice (0–9)

[seznam znaků]

Libovolný jednotlivý znak uvedený v seznamu znaků

[!seznam znaků]

Libovolný jednotlivý znak neuvedený v seznamu znaků


Můžete použít skupinu jeden nebo víc znaků (seznam znaků) v závorkách ([]) odpovídá libovolný jednotlivý znak ve výrazu a seznam znaků mohou obsahovat téměř žádné znaky v Znaková sada ANSI, včetně číslic. Můžete použít speciální znaky levá hranatá závorka ([]), otazník (?), symbol čísla (#) nebo hvězdičku (*) při porovnání přímo pouze v případě uzavřen v závorkách. Pravá hranatá závorka (]) nelze použít v rámci skupiny podle sebe sama, ale můžete ho mimo skupinu jako samostatný znak.

Kromě simple seznam znaky uzavřené v závorkách najdete seznam znaků zadat rozsah znaků pomocí pomlčkou (-), která odděluje spodní a horní hranici rozsahu. Například aplikaci [A-Z] vzorku za následek shodu odpovídající pozice znaku v výraz obsahující jakékoli velké písmeno v rozsahu A až Z. Bez omezující oblastí může obsahovat více oblastí v hranatých závorkách. Příklad: [a-zA-Z0 – 9] odpovídá jakýkoli alfanumerický znak.

Je důležité mít na paměti, že zástupné znaky ANSI SQL (%) a (_) jsou k dispozici pouze s databázový stroj Microsoft Access a přístup zprostředkovatele OLE DB. Budou se použije jako literály, pokud prostřednictvím aplikace Access nebo DAO použít.

Další důležitá pravidla pro vzorů patřit následující úkoly:

  • Vykřičník (!) na začátku seznamu znaků znamená, že je shodu volání Pokud libovolnému znaku kromě těch, které v seznamu znaků najdete ve výrazu. Při použití mimo závorky, odpovídá vykřičník samotné.

  • Můžete pomlčka (-) na začátku (po vykřičník pokud používá) nebo na konci seznamu znaků podle sebe sama. Kdekoli jinde jsou uvedeny spojovníku oblasti standard ANSI znaky.

  • Zadat rozsah znaků znaky musí zobrazí seřadit vzestupně (A-Z nebo 0-100). [A-Z] se řídí určitým vzorem platné, ale není [Z-a.].

  • [] Posloupnost znaků ignorované; To je považován za Řetězec nulové délky ("").



Poznámka : Upozornění ke strojovému překladu: Tento článek přeložil počítačový systém bez zásahu člověka. Společnost Microsoft nabízí tyto strojové překlady proto, aby umožnila uživatelům, kteří nemluví anglicky, získat informace o produktech, službách a technologiích této společnosti. Protože je tento článek strojově přeložený, může obsahovat slovní, syntaktické nebo gramatické chyby.

Rozšiřte své znalosti a dovednosti
Projít školení
Získejte nové funkce jako první
Připojte se k účastníkům programu Office Insiders

Byly tyto informace užitečné?

Děkujeme vám za zpětnou vazbu.

Děkujeme vám za váš názor. Vypadá to, že bude užitečné, když vás spojíme s některým z našich agentů z podpory Office.

×